The Hokes Bluff Eagles will head out to challenge the Cherokee County Warriors at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
On Friday, Hokes Bluff ended up a good deal behind Alexandria and lost 39-21. The Eagles haven't had much luck with the Valley Cubs recently, as the team has come up short the last three times they've met.

Despite the defeat, Hokes Bluff got top-tier performance from Bryce Whitaker, who rushed for 135 yards and one TD on only 12 carries. Whitaker is crushing it when it comes to rushing yards: he's rushed for at least 135 every time he's taken the field this season.
Meanwhile, Cherokee County came up short against Anniston on Friday and fell 20-13.
Hokes Bluff's loss dropped their record down to 4-2. As for Cherokee County, their defeat was their first in the region, dropping their region record down to 3-1 and their overall record down to 5-2.
Things could have been worse for Hokes Bluff, but things could have been a whole lot better as they took a 35-21 loss to Cherokee County in their previous meeting back in October of 2024. Can the Eagles av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
